According to Jeremy Parish of 1UP, Mass Effect 3 on the Wii U has technical issues. He explains:

This version of ME3 seems a lot less visually stable than, say, the Xbox 360 version — the frame rate is choppier, the animation seems rougher. The audio suffers, too; while the music and sound effects have come over fine, all the dialogue has a hollow, echoing quality to it.

Combined with the fact that the future downloadable content might not be released for the platform, this version of the game is appearing less and less appealing as time marches on.
